Nikon Eclipse E-600 upright microscope

Roger Gaudry Building, Room N-620
Simple Microscope usage price

  • Applications

    • BrightfieldBright-field

    • Phase Contrast

    • Polarized light

    • Fluorescence

    • Color camera
  • Light sources

    • Halogen lamp for 30 W transmitted light

    • Mercury lamp (350~600nm) for fluorescence 

    • Lumencor SOLA V-nIR

  • Filter cubes

    • DAPI/Hoechst/AMCA

    • FITC/EGFP

    • TRITC/Rhodamine

    • TexasRed

    • Empty
    • Empty

    Stand

    • Nikon Eclipse E600 E600W upright Serial 725540

    Light sources

    • Transmitted light Halogen 12V 100W Serial Model C-LPSerial 01875599
    • Reflected light

    Condenser

    • Condenser Universal C-CU Serial 081901
    • Lens Dry NA 0.9
    • Filters: Empty, Ph1, Ph2, Ph3, DICM, DICH, Empty

    Objectives

    • 4x/0.13
    • 10x/0.3 Plan Fluor Ph1 DLL WD 16 Air
    • 20x/
    • 40x/0.75 Plan Fluor Ph2 DLL WD 0.72 Air with PF40 Wollaston prism
    • 60x/0.85
    • 100x/1.3 Plan Fluor Ph3 DLL WD 0.2 Oil with PF/PA 100 Oil Wollaston prismEmpty

    Detector

    • Color Camera Nikon DS-Ri2 Serial 701234

    Workstation

    • HP Z440 Workstation
    • Intel Xeon E5-1630 v3 @ 3.7GHz
    • RAM 32 GB DDR4 2133 MHz  (4 x 8 GB)
    • OS 256GB 256 GB SSD 550 MBs
    • 2TB 2 TB HD Data Storage 150 MBs
    • Video Card NVIDIA Quadro K620 2 GB DDR3 dedicated memory
    • Monitor HP Z24i display 24' 1920x12001920 x 1200

    Consumables

    Mercury lamp bulb OSRAM HBO 1003W/2 100W
